10 Best Practices for Meta Tags in SEO

By Hassan Mar10,2024

Meta tags are snippets of code that provide information about a webpage, making it easier for search engines to understand the content. These tags are essential for search engine optimization (SEO) as they help search engines determine the relevance and context of a page. Meta tags include meta titles, meta descriptions, meta keywords, and other additional tags that provide further information about the webpage.

The importance of meta tags in SEO cannot be overstated. They play a crucial role in determining how a webpage is indexed, categorized, and displayed in search engine results pages (SERPs). When optimized effectively, meta tags can improve a website’s visibility, click-through rates, and ultimately, its search engine rankings.

Best Practices for Meta Tags

Meta Title

Importance of Meta Title

The meta title is one of the most critical meta tags as it is usually the first thing users see in search results. It directly affects the click-through rate and should accurately represent the content of the page.

Best Practices for Meta Title

  1. Keep it concise and informative: Limit the title to 50-60 characters to ensure it displays correctly in search results.
  2. Include keywords: Incorporate relevant keywords to improve visibility and relevance.
  3. Use a compelling call to action: Encourage users to click on your link with persuasive language.
  4. Optimize for social media: Ensure the title is shareable and engaging for social media platforms.

Meta Description

Importance of Meta Description

The meta description provides a brief summary of the webpage’s content. It appears below the meta title in search results and influences users’ decision to click on a link. A compelling meta description can increase click-through rates.

Best Practices for Meta Description

  1. Keep it concise and engaging: Limit the description to 150-160 characters for optimal display.
  2. Include keywords: Incorporate relevant keywords to signal the content’s relevance to search engines.
  3. Write a unique description for each page: Avoid duplicating meta descriptions to ensure each page stands out.
  4. Optimize for click-through rate: Craft a description that entices users to click on the link for more information.

Meta Keywords

Importance of Meta Keywords

meta keywords were crucial for SEO, but search engines like Google no longer use them to determine rankings. However, they can still be beneficial for other search engines, making them worth including.

Best Practices for Meta Keywords

  1. Use relevant keywords: Choose keywords that accurately describe the content of the page.
  2. Avoid keyword stuffing: Use keywords naturally and avoid overusing them.
  3. Use a keyword research tool: Find the most relevant and high-performing keywords for your content.

Other Meta Tags

Importance of Other Meta Tags

In addition to meta titles, descriptions, and keywords, other meta tags play a significant role in optimizing a website for search engines.

Best Practices for Other Meta Tags

  1. Use the canonical tag to prevent duplicate content: Specify the preferred version of a webpage to avoid duplicate content issues.
  2. Use the robots tag to control how search engines crawl your site: Direct search engine bots on what content to crawl and index.
  3. Use the viewport tag to optimize your site for mobile devices: Ensure a responsive design for mobile users by setting the viewport meta tag.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are meta tags in SEO?

Meta tags are snippets of text that describe a page’s content. They do not appear on the actual page but in the code of the page, telling search engines what the page is about.

Why are meta tags important for SEO?

Meta tags play a crucial role in SEO as they help search engines understand the content of a webpage. They can influence how a page is indexed and displayed in search results.

How many meta tags should I use on a page?

While there is no exact number, it is recommended to include relevant meta tags such as title, description, and keywords. Avoid overstuffing tags as it may be flagged as spam.

What are some best practices for meta tags in SEO?

Some best practices for meta tags in SEO include using unique and descriptive meta titles and descriptions, incorporating relevant keywords, and ensuring tags are concise and relevant to the page content.

How should meta tags be optimized for mobile SEO?

For mobile SEO, it is important to ensure that meta tags are optimized for smaller screens. This includes using shorter titles and descriptions, testing for mobile friendliness, and implementing structured data markup for rich results.
